Background
Gregory Dunson is a 2026 prospect suiting up for Alexander High School in Georgia, where he's developing his craft as a floor general. As an underclassman point guard in the competitive Georgia prep landscape, Dunson is building his reputation on the AAU circuit while handling significant responsibilities for his high school squad.
Playing Style
Dunson's game is built around aggressive rim attacks and a relentless mindset getting to the charity stripe, showing the type of fearless drives that separate good point guards from great ones. His ability to consistently draw fouls suggests excellent body control and timing when navigating traffic in the paint. As a floor general, he demonstrates the court awareness to know when to be aggressive for his own offense while maintaining his primary responsibility of orchestrating the team's attack. The combination of his attacking mentality and point guard instincts makes him an intriguing developmental prospect.
